**Action item (PM-214, Quillhaven partner drop):** The SFTP ingest stalled because the retry loop backed off past the partner's file-expiry window, and the drop rotated before we reconnected. On-call: the fix tightens retry spacing and adds a hard deadline so we alert instead of silently looping. If the alert fires, pull the file manually and ack the incident. Verify the poller picks up the new values after deploy. They are listed below.

tuning constants:
THRESHOLDS = {
    "briael": 916,
    "gilox": 448,
    "eliion": 485,
    "brivan": 771,
    "casdor": 265,
}

Hi all — quick facilities update from the Brindlecote office. The first-aid room on level 2 has been restocked and the old cabinet lock replaced after last month's jammed-key saga. Team assistants: please don't prop the door open anymore, even during supply deliveries — it messes with the temperature control for the medication fridge. If someone needs supplies outside reception hours, you can let them in yourselves now. The new keypad is on the right of the door frame, and the current code is below.

door code, tahop-fahap: bdg-JZCXMY-37375484

Ticket: FIELD-2281 — Expired credentials blocking offline sync

For the weekly sync: the Heronpath field-survey app's offline mode stopped reconciling on Monday because the cached sync token expired while crews were out of coverage. Surveys queued locally are intact, but uploads fail silently until re-auth. We've extended token lifetime to 30 days and reissued credentials. The replacement key for the internal sync service follows.

service key, fafog-fahaf: vxb3-x55

### Invoice Renderer (Paperquill)

The Paperquill service converts invoice JSON into signed PDFs via `POST /render`. Renders are synchronous and usually complete within two seconds; anything longer indicates a queue backlog worth paging on. Failed renders return a `render_trace` ID for log correlation. All requests to the internal renderer must include the service key shown on the line below.

API key for tagef-fafop: vxb2-ta